Description
Edwards & Gray are delighted to offer for sale this three bedroom mid terraced home in Harborne. It is the perfect location for easy access to the QE hospital and the University of Birmingham, and is also handy to make use of the amenities that both Harborne and Selly Oak offers. There are good transport links, with the University train station nearby and the number 11 bus route. There are local schools rated good and outstanding. The property comprises of three bedrooms and a family bathroom upstairs, whilst downstairs has a separate dining room and living room, and the kitchen. It benefits from central heating and UPVC double glazing. There is a front garden, and private rear garden with a patio. The home still retains some period features but is ready for some modernisation, and is available with no upward chain.
